Transcriptomic analysis of circulating leukocytes in early postpartum dairy cows with evidence of uterine disease and associated physiological changes

The aim of this study was to describe consequences of uterine disease and associated physiological changes on peripheral leukocyte gene function. The top ranked gene during every rank or error test was PGLYRP1. Its associated metabolite, peptidoglycan recognition protein 1, and other immunomodulatory molecules associated with this study (e.g. CATHL6, LCN2,6 BTLA, IL-17D) are attractive candidates for diagnostic and therapeutic development in that they selectively enhance or alter host innate immune defense mechanisms, and modulate pathogen-induced inflammatory responses.
